How Perforator works

Perforator provides detailed insights into server resource usage and analyzes the impact of code on performance, highlighting which applications consume the most system resources. Perforator uses eBPF technology to run small programs within the Linux kernel in a way that is safe and does not slow down the system. eBPF allows for improved monitoring, security, and performance optimization without changing the source code.

Perforator supports native programming languages such as C, C++, Go, Rust, Python, and Java. The solution enables in-depth analytics and data visualization with flame graphs, making problem diagnostics much more manageable.

One of Perforator's key advantages is its support for profile-guided optimization (PGO), which automatically accelerates C++ programs by up to 10%. Additionally, Perforator is designed to run seamlessly on individual computers, making it accessible not only to large businesses but also to startups and tech enthusiasts. Furthermore, Perforator offers essential features tailored for large organizations, including A/B testing capabilities that help make better-informed decisions.
